GPON Topology

The document compares PSCA and PON network designs. It analyzes their differences in terms of cost, reliability, bandwidth increases, sustainability, fault impacts and more. It concludes that the current PSCA network design is better for most factors, but a PON network would be better for energy consumption and maintenance due to splitters.
